英文释义

n. the relation between opposing principles or forces or factors
n. an actively expressed feeling of dislike and hostility
n. (biochemistry) interference in or inhibition of the physiological action of a chemical substance by another having a similar structure

中文翻译

n. 对立, 敌对, 敌意
[化] 拮抗作用; 消效作用
